Hey all — quick heads-up for the sync: we're changing ownership of log sampling for the Chattermill ingest service. Sampling moves from 1:10 to adaptive, and the config now lives in the observability repo. I'm rotating off the project at month's end, so going forward all sampling changes should be approved by the person named below.

account owner for fajep-yagef: Kasix Eliiel

Subject: DR drill — CrashLedger pipeline

On-call: we're failing over the Pinewhistle crash-report ingest tonight at 02:00. Expect a 10-minute gap in symbolication; mobile uploads will buffer. Verify the replay queue drains after cutover and file anomalies in the drill doc. To unlock the standby vault, use the passphrase below.

unlock words, fawif-hahip: eliax-ulador-holdor-novix-prawyn-norius-kelax-weniel-alddor-ulaion

Leadership Review Briefing — Northbay Expansion

For branch managers. Kestrel Logistics opens its Northbay corridor in Q2. Two depots confirmed; third site under negotiation near Alderport. Staffing: 40 hires, led by interim manager Suri Valtane. Existing branches release no more than two transfers each. Marketing launch holds until permits clear. Expect routing changes to be circulated after the review. The underlying commercial objective is stated in the note below.

board note of kageg-bahof: The renewal with Holwynax Holdings closes at $2 million a year, 5 percent below the last contract. Project Ulaath slips by two quarters because of the supplier delay.

Ticket: temp site access — night shift. While the Harlowden Annex is torn apart for renovation, we've shifted operations to the portacabin cluster in the rear yard off Grayme Street. Night crew: the main annex doors are sealed, so don't bother with your usual fobs. Use the yard gate, then the second cabin on the left — that's the ops room. The keypad on the cabin door takes the code below.

staff pass of bafog-kajop = bdg-VL-3